wince的用法和样例:
例句
- Mention branding and a wince passes around the table.一提及品牌推广,畏缩情绪就传遍了整张桌子。
- His smile soon modified to a wince.他的微笑很快就成了脸部肌肉的抽搐。
- That statistic must surely make them wince.这样的统计数据必定会让他们退缩。
- As soon as he touched her she seemed to wince and stiffen.只消他碰到她,她便一阵畏缩,全身僵硬。
- I still wince at the memory of the stupid thing I did.我一想起自己做过的蠢事就不由得摇头叹气。
- He winced mentally at the terrible news.听到这个噩耗,他不由的心里一楞。
- He winced as she stood on his injured foot.她踩着他受伤的脚,他疼得缩了回去。
